what advancement from the industrial revolution that had a significant impact on agriculture and discuss the benifits this advancement had on the industry

1 Answer

3 votes

Answer:

In the short term, enclosure needed more labourers to build the farms and the fences. In the long term, however, increased use of machinery meant that fewer farm workers were needed. They left the land and went to the industrial towns of the north of England.
